IT Infrastructure & Security Consulting Services
ScienceSoft offers custom software development to design and build software solutions, catering to organizations’ unique needs. With 32 years in IT and 700 employees onboard, ScienceSoft provides all-round custom software development services to deploy highly customized software with speed and quality.
TAILORED SOLUTIONS for every type of business process
Enterprise resource & process management
- Asset management
- Project & task management
- Resource & workload management
Customer-centered software
- Asset management
- Project & task management
- Resource & workload management
Financial management & accounting
- Asset management
- Project & task management
- Resource & workload management
Knowledge & productivity
- Asset management
- Project & task management
- Resource & workload management
Supply chain management
- Asset management
- Project & task management
- Resource & workload management
Analytics
- Asset management
- Project & task management
- Resource & workload management
Emergency & security
- Asset management
- Project & task management
- Resource & workload management
Connected and smart
- Asset management
- Project & task management
- Resource & workload management
what industry are you from?
We develop all types of industry-specific software. Choose your industry to check our offering.
CHOOSE YOUR SERVICE OPTION
Software Consulting
Our subject-matter experts will assess your needs and come up with possible software solutions. They’ll advise on techs and architecture design, as well as provide a rough estimation of time and costs.
End-to-end Software Development
We will support you through the full software development cycle – from initial needs analysis to the implementation and adoption of the new software solution.
Legacy Software Modernization
To help you get more agility and efficiency, we can re-code or re-architect your legacy solutions with modern techs and architectural patterns, migrate them to the cloud, extend their reach and functionality, and more.
RELATED SERVICES
Integration
We can integrate new software with other tools you already use – be they custom-made or platform-based – like ERP, CRM, PDM, MES, vendor and customer portals, and more.
API development
We can build clean, secure and well-documented APIs to help you extend enterprise-wide automation or enable smooth integration of your custom solution with other internal or external systems.
Continuous support
We can take over responsibility for consistent performance management, troubleshooting, evolution and change management to keep your software healthy, relevant and high-performing.
Why develop with ntsi
- Сustom software development company with 20+ years of experience
- Full-cycle software development
- Over 700 employees on board, and the partner network of 5 companies with 700 employees.
- 2,695 success stories (including projects for Walmart, eBay, NASA JPL, PerkinElmer, Baxter, IBM, Orange, BBC, MTV)
- 76% of the revenue comes from 1+ year-long customers
- 8 Gold Microsoft competencies and Silver Oracle partnership competencies; Microsoft Cloud Computing Partner Program member and AWS Select Consulting Partner
- Featured in Forrester’s 2018 Now Tech overview as a recommended custom software provider
- BBB Accredited Business
OUR HALLMARK CUSTOM SOFTWARE DEVELOPMENT PROJECTS
COST OF CUSTOM SOFTWARE DEVELOPMENT
The cost of custom software development depends on your project’s scale and complexity shaped by multiple factors, such as:
- Software type and a number of platforms supported (web, mobile, desktop).
- Number and complexity of software features.
- Design uniqueness and complexity.
- Number and complexity of integrations with other software systems.
- Infrastructure requirements (availability, performance, security, latent capacity and scalability).
We will be pleased to provide an estimate for your project.
- Custom vs off-the-shelf software: What's the difference?
we help our customers to innovate
We employ our hands-on experience in cutting-edge technologies to help our customers get the most of modern tech capabilities and stay ahead of the competition.
Big Data
Artificial Intelligence
Data Science
Internet of Things
Computer Vision
Augmented Reality
Virtual Reality
Blockchain
TECHNOLOGIES WE USE
We employ the proven combination of the latest and classic trusted technologies, having the following technology stack as our basis:
Back end
Click on the technology to learn about our capabilities in it.
Front end
Click on the technology to learn about our capabilities in it.
Mobile
Click on the technology to learn about our capabilities in it.
Desktop
Click on the technology to learn about our capabilities in it.
Databases / data storages
Click on the technology to learn about our capabilities in it.
SQL
NOSQL
Cloud databases (DBaaS)
AWS
AZURE
GOOGLE CLOUD PLATFORM
Big data
Click on the technology to learn about our capabilities in it.
Platforms
Click on the platform to learn about our capabilities in it.
DevOps
FAQ ON CUSTOM SOFTWARE DEVELOPMENT
Answered by Boris Shiklo, Chief Technology Officer at ScienceSoft
What engagement models does ScienceSoft offer?
We offer full process outsourcing, dedicated team, and staff augmentation. The outsourcing model choice depends on the nature of customer needs (improve the development process or fill specific skill gaps) and the desired level of project control.
What development methodologies does ScienceSoft use?
We commonly use Agile (Scrum, Kanban, XP) to enable fast releases and easy changes. In case accurately predictable budgets/timelines or adherence to industry regulations are in demand, we employ Waterfall. And we offer the Iterative model when a customer wants both project flexibility and predictability.
we deliver with speed, quality and agility
The success of our software comes from:
- A dedicated PM for each project who organizes the work for the benefit of transparency and visibility, coordinates communication with your in-house team and third parties, continuously re-evaluates requirements and manages risks.
- Effective collaboration with project stakeholders.
- All-round requirements analysis and management
Want to Develop Software that Lasts?
With the high level of technical excellence and detailed knowledge of business domains we can help you always stay one step ahead of competition.